(The River Cooum originates in a village of the same name, about 70 km away from Chennai. Once a fresh water source is today a drainage course inside Chennai, collecting surpluses of 75 small tanks of a minor basin. The length of the river is about 65 km, of which 18 km fall within the Chennai city limits. Once a fishing river and boat racing ground, it has borne the brunt of the city’s unplanned explosion. The Kesavaram dam diverts the river into the Chembarambakkam Lake from which water is utilized for the supply of drinking water to the city of Chennai. Thereafter, the flow of water in the river is much reduced.)

It’s known to be the city’s smelly eyesore, so it should hardly come as a surprise that the Cooum river is a killer water body with high toxic content. It is even estimated that, when flowing within city limits, has more toxins than even a sewer. A 72-km-long channel, the Cooum originates in the neighbouring Tiruvallur district and winds its way through Chennai before flowing into the Bay of Bengal. Tests undertaken to gauge the extent of pollution downstream showed fish could survive for only three to five hours in water near the mouth of the river in Chepauk even after the samples were diluted up to 50% (without aeration). The water has almost no dissolved oxygen, and instead there are traces of heavy metals like copper, besides sewage and sludge.
